大数据开发需要编程语言的基础,因为大数据的开发基于一些常用的高级语言,比如Java和.Net。不论是hadoop,还是数据挖掘,都需要有高级编程语言的基础。因此,如果想学习大数据开发,还是需要至少精通一门高级语言。计算机编程语言有...
Hadoop高级编程、大数据分析技术、大数据管理与集成、NoSQL数据库、Python程序设计与应用、应用统计学与R语言建模、大数据分析与运用、数据建模与MATLAB应用。
(5)MaoReduce太麻烦,用熟悉的方式操作Hadoop里的数据——Pig、Hive、Jaql。(6)让你的数据可见——Drilldown、Intellicus。(7)用高级语言管理你的任务流——Oozie、Cascading。(8)Hadoop自己的监控管理工具——Hue、Karmasph...
在技术方面你将彻底掌握基本的Hadoop集群;HadoopHDFS原理;HadoopHDFS基本的命令;Namenode的工作机制;HDFS基本配置管理;MapRece原理;HBase的系统架构;HBase的表结构;HBase如何使用MapRece;MapRece高级编程;split的实现详解;Hive入门;Hive...
学大数据部分之前要先学习一种计算机编程语言。【大数据开发】需要编程语言的基础,因为大数据的开发基于一些常用的高级语言,比如Java和.Net。不论是hadoop,还是数据挖掘,都需要有高级编程语言的基础。因此,如果想学习大数据开发...
(2)分布式存储和分布式计算框架hadoop、内存计算框架spark发展很成熟并在企业广泛部署;(3)面向对象设计思想已经发展很成熟,自底向上的设计思想函数式编程发展的也十分成熟,海量数据并发处理技术也发展很成熟,非结构化数据的处理...
Java是门高端的计算机编程语言,学大数据不论是hadoop,还是数据挖掘,都需要有高级编程语言的基础,而Hadoop以及其他大数据处理技术很多都是用Java,例如Apache的基于Java的HBase和Accumulo以及ElasticSearchas,因此学习Hadoop的一个...
肯定第一步是配置spark环境:包括linux系统的安装,java,ssh,Hadoop,Scala,spark的安装与环境变量设置。虽说简单,但对于初学者说,尤其是没有使用过linux系统的,还是有些挑战。其中遗漏一些细节问题,都会出错。第二步:...
基于Hadoop做开发可以使用任何语言,因为hadoop提高了streaming编程框架和pipes编程接口,streaming框架下用户可以使用任何可以操作标准输入输出的计算机语言来开发hadoop应用。(14)在reduce阶段老是卡在最后阶段很长时间,在网上查的说是有可能是...
RunAnywhere。内嵌式行业好像为Java量身定做打造出。6、互联网大数据:Hadoop及其别的大数据处理技术性许多全是用Java。7、科学研究运用:Java的安全系数、便携式让Java在科学研究运用、金融信息服务、室内空间极大。